Last week I attended the SugarCON 2008 Conference in San Jose, California.  The conference itself was held at the Dolce Hayes Mansion, a magnificent mansion with a bit of history to it.

Dolce Hayes Mansion - San Jose, California

Being opened to the public in 1994 the Mansion offers 214 guest rooms, more than 33,000 square feet of meeting space and 22 specially designed conference rooms. If you’re into the total relaxation then you can also book an appointment at their onsite spa.

It was roughly a 35-40 minute drive from San Francisco International (SFO), and about 10 minutes from the San Jose International (SJC).  The Dolce Hayes Mansion is also situated near many vineyards such as the one we visited briefly; The Testarossa Vineyards.

The room I stayed at was typical of most hotel rooms; king sized bed, desk with high-speed internet access, a TV (not like the one I had at the Hilton Garden Inn), bar fridge and a nice sized bathroom.

The staff seemed to be friendly and helpful when you needed something (which is expected right?), the rooms were done up neatly and quickly while we were at our information sessions and the food was great. Being at a conference we were treated to the breakfast buffet and lunch buffet.

Overall the Dolce Hayes Mansion was nice. Though I don’t see myself going there to vacation, but as a business trip location it was enjoyable and relaxing.
